How To Get Rid Of Painful Knots On The Outside Of Vagina?

Hi, I continue to get these knots (cysts) on the outside of my vagina that are very painful. It s painful to wipe to wash, dry, pat after urination, etc. Can you help me. I can t even think about shaving when this is happening. Generally it lasts for about 1 to 2 weeks.

Cysts are more likely to cause pain when they get infected. Vaginal cysts can become infected by the normal bacteria found on the skin or by a sexually transmitted infection. Infected vaginal cysts can form an abscess -- a pus-filled lump that can be very painful
You might need to have a biopsy of the cyst to rule out cancer.
To relieve any discomfort you're having from a vaginal cyst, sit in a bathtub filled with a few inches of warm water (called a sitz bath) several times a day for three or four days.
To treat an infected vaginal cyst, you may need to take antibiotics.
It's also possible to have surgery to remove the entire cyst if you're very uncomfortable or the cyst keeps returning. Some health care providers recommend that women over age 40 have surgery to remove a vaginal cyst because of the possibility that it might be cancerous. Cysts that are treated with surgery usually don't come back
